## Partner SFTP Drop — Marlowe Freight

Files land nightly between 02:00–03:30 UTC in the inbound drop. Watcher job `marlowe-ingest` picks them up; if nothing arrives by 04:00, the Quillhook alert fires. Do NOT re-request files from Marlowe before checking the quarantine folder — malformed headers get parked there silently. Retries are safe; ingest is idempotent on file checksum. Rotation of the drop credentials is quarterly, owned by platform. Full escalation steps and contacts are on the runbook page.

dashboard of taduf-tahof = https://confluence.tolvaqlabs.internal/browse/browse/display/f01240ca

Before sharding the Pellgrove profile store, confirm the migration window with the support lead and freeze profile writes. Each shard coordinator reads its topology from the central registry at startup. The coordinator authenticates to the registry with a shard token, which you should place in the env file on the following line.

vault entry, yahif-yajep: COURIER_KEY29=b802bdf8034096b65a51c6ba5abe2

### Tide-table widget refresh logic (Shorecast app)

Quick note for whoever inherits this: the widget polls the Brinewatch feed, but we deliberately refresh way less often than you'd think, since tides don't exactly sneak up on you. The tricky part is the interpolation window around slack tide — too narrow and the curve looks steppy. Current tuning constants live here.

tuning table, fawip-fahag:
WEIGHTS = {
    "novwyn": 452,
    "casdor": 675,
}

## Authentication

The encoding-detection service (Glyphsort) inspects uploaded text files and guesses charset before ingestion. It runs as a separate microservice; the main Fernhollow app calls it over HTTP. All calls require a bearer token. Tokens are scoped per environment — staging tokens will not work against production, and vice versa. Do not hardcode tokens in source. Export the token as `GLYPHSORT_TOKEN` in your local shell. Sample uploads live in `fixtures/encodings/`. The current staging token is provided below.

API key for hahop-kagag: qvz23-9rgwklpVrQxgjhKytQ3CsZ6